I've searched but was unable to find a replacement antenna that's about 3-4 inches shorter than the stock 30"

 

I don't listen to FM or HD radio in any of my cars, I prefer SiriusXM, so I really don't need an stick antenna on the truck anyway. However, as with most people, I hate that it hits my garage door opening every time I go in and out.

I changed my Ram Laramie to a shorty antenna that was like 7" long, but to be honest, it looked a bit out of place.

What I desire is for the antenna to be about 1-2 inches higher than the shark fin antenna for the SiriusXM and GPS that's on the roof. This way it won't hit my garage opening, but the 26-27" antenna would still be about 2-3 inches higher than the shark fin antenna, giving me a heads up if the truck will clear a low hanging parking garage that may not have the height requirement bar in place at the entrance.

 

Any leads on a 26-27 inch high all black stick antenna would be appreciated.

Almost all of the GM antenna's use the same thread mount. Just go to the lot and measure the different antenna's and order one the size you want.

Cut your stock antenna to the height you want and use one of those little rubber vacuum plugs on the top of it. I did that In one of my other cars.
